If I were to pick one food to have on hand for unexpected demands, it would be rice. It's CHEAP and a couple of 40 lb. sacks would go a long way.
 
As far as water is concerned, why not ask friends to save and store empty 2 liter soda bottles for you? It costs them nothing to do so. Then, if TSHTF, at least they'll have a way to quickly store water.
